ROCKY MOUNT - William "Billy" Louis Odom, Jr., age 60, passed away peacefully on Wednesday, May 23, 2018. Born in Nash County, NC on December 4, 1957, he was the son of William Louis Odom, Sr. and Barbara Groves Odom. He was preceded in death by his mother, Barbara.
Billy graduated from Rocky Mount Senior High and UNC-Chapel Hill. He was a scholar, a poet, a writer, a lover of books and he loved to entertain family and friends with his gift of storytelling. Billy also used his magical voice to bring "sight" to the stories as he read to the blind through radio media. He was a journalist for several newspapers throughout his career.
